Commission President advances global cooperation on carbon pricing in high-level event at COP28

  • Commission President Ursula von der Leyen hosted a high-level event at COP28 to promote the development of carbon pricing and carbon markets. She highlighted that carbon pricing is the centerpiece of the European Green Deal and emphasized the success of the EU Emissions Trading System (EU ETS) in reducing emissions and raising funds.
  • Many countries around the world have embraced carbon pricing, but there is a need to go further and faster.
  • The European Union is ready to share its experience and support other countries in implementing carbon pricing regimes. The event also featured participation from the World Bank, World Trade Organization, and International Monetary Fund, who all emphasized the importance of carbon pricing for the climate and a fair transition.
  • The Commission will continue to provide technical support to countries and ensure the integrity of international carbon markets. The goal is to establish a credible standard that drives transformative investment and avoids unsustainable emissions levels. Carbon pricing is a central part of the EU’s climate policies, and emissions trading will soon apply to new sectors in Europe.
  • The Call to Action on Paris-aligned Carbon Markets, launched in June 2023, has received support from 31 countries and focuses on expanding domestic carbon pricing, supporting international compliance markets, and ensuring integrity in voluntary carbon markets.
